The University of Lagos (UNILAG) is a foremost architecture school in Nigeria. The school offers a five-year Bachelor of Architecture (B.Arch) degree program. The curriculum is comprehensive and covers various disciplines such as design, history, theory, structures, construction, and environmental control. UNILAG also has a strong research focus and offers postgraduate programs in architecture.
